MEMO — Heads of Department

Pilot with Drossfield Markets starts in four weeks. Twelve stores, northern region only. Logistics: ship via the Kestrel Cross depot. KPIs: sell-through, returns rate, staff feedback. No external comms until results are in. Direct questions to the commercial lead. Review the pilot's strategic basis, which follows immediately below.

management briefing: Project Ulavan slips by two quarters because of the staffing delay.

Subject: Hedging decision — final

Team,

Decision made. We're hedging 70% of projected Veltran-market receivables for the next four quarters. Forward contracts, not options. Rationale: swing last quarter cost us real margin, and the pipeline there is growing fast. Impact on you: quote in local currency, margins hold, no ad-hoc FX padding in deals. Anything outside standard terms goes through Corin before signature. No exceptions this time. Full mechanics in the finance pack Monday. One element of the plan is not for circulation.

board note of bajop-yaweg: The western region missed its Pelys quota by 58.0 percent last quarter. Pelysek Foods plans to raise the Belius list price by 44.0 percent in July. The steering committee signed off on a budget of $133.8 million for Project Pelax. The renewal with Zoraelix Systems closes at $61.9 million a year, 12.7 percent above the last contract.

TICKET-4412: Schema vault locked after failed rotation. The Fennwick event schema registry can't validate new topic definitions because the signing vault sealed itself mid-deploy. Reviewer: check the unseal branch before merging — the retry loop in vault_client.go masks the sealed state and returns stale schemas. Producers on the Larkspur cluster are pinned to v3 until this lands. To unseal locally for testing, use the team recovery passphrase below.

strongbox words: frawyn-briion-soriel

Ticket: Staging env misconfigured for Siftgate bloom filter

The bloom layer in front of the Pellet KV store is rejecting all lookups in staging because the env file was copied from the dev template without credentials. False-positive tuning values are fine; only the auth line is missing. To unblock the weekly demo, the Pellet admission secret must be set on the following line.

env line for yaguf-fajop: LEDGER_TOKEN13=fb08984397349